A lot of states, like Connecticut, Idaho, Indiana, Maryland, Michigan, Minnesota, Nevada, New Jacket, Utah, and Wisconsin, use licenses as a journeyman or master plumbing professional, though there are distinctions in the sorts of licenses offered and whether they're required whatsoever. Your state's department of business, division of labor, or a similar regulative board might offer more info on this.
New York State does not have a plumbing specialist certificate need, but they're often required by city and area federal governments. For instance, while New york city City enables anybody to do journeyman pipes job, however to become a master plumbing professional, they should submit an application to get a master plumber license.
A journeyman plumbing technician in New York can function under the instructions of a master plumbing professional, installing new water and gas lines, and doing fixings. A master plumbing technician has no limitations and can oversee the work of journeyman plumbers and apprentices in commercial plumbing. They can also create plumbing schematics, plan water supply, and job straight with code enforcement police officers in the building market.
Plumbing technicians in Texas have to have a state permit from the Texas State Board of Pipes Inspectors as either a tradesman plumber, a journeyman plumbing professional, a master plumbing technician, or a plumbing assessor. A tradesperson plumbing technician's certificate requires at the very least two years of experience in the pipes field as a pupil. An apprentice does not require a license, but they have to be signed up with the state.
To obtain a master plumbing professional's permit, an applicant has to have been accredited as a Journeyman Plumbing in Texas or one more state for a minimum of one year, and have actually finished an accepted training program. Master plumbing licenses gotten in various other states will certainly additionally qualify a candidate for a master plumber license in Texas.

Usually, plumbing technicians bill customers based on the quantity of time, competence, and materials required to get a task done. Labor accounts for the biggest piece of a pipes spending plan. Maintain in mind that pipes firms will certainly need to send the appropriate variety of plumbings required to get a task done effectively within a reasonable quantity of time.
Advised Articles The truth is that licensed plumbers can execute hundreds of jobs in the restroom, kitchen, cellar, and beyond. Plumbers even deal with slab job, sewer-line job, septic work, and various other projects that require to be completed on the outside of your home. The very same plumbing technician capable of dealing with a disaster with your sewer line can additionally provide you a simple quote for tankless water heater expense.
A plumber could be at your residence anywhere from a couple of hours to a number of weeks. While pipes work that need even more time will normally cost you more by means of the advancing hourly price, a lot of plumbers will certainly also charge even more based on the complexity and location of the piping work.
However, some plumbing professionals will charge level prices for straightforward jobs that they do routinely. They have the ability to do this because they can precisely calculate the amount of time, labor, and materials required to unclog a drain, take care of a running bathroom, or resolve some other usual home plumbing issue. Most plumbing professionals likewise bill a phone call charge that covers the price of going to a home to give a quote.
Image: Portra/ E+/ Getty Images, Your plumbing professional will need to variable in the damage that your project is placing on devices when producing your expense estimate. Sometimes, a plumber might really need to get an unique device particularly for your project. A plumbing technician will certainly still factor in tool prices for a simple repair due to the truth that this relatively straightforward task requires the plumbing to gather and prepare all of the right tools and materials ahead of time.
Like the majority of specialists, plumbers will certainly charge customers extra if they are beyond a recommended area. Trip charges cover the price of gas and vehicle deterioration. Constantly make sure to ask a plumbing company if you are within its work area prior to asking for a solution call. Usually, plumbing companies will charge an additional $50 to $300 in trip costs for clients located greater than 10 miles away.
While they will certainly react to after-hours calls, they will just appear to your home if you accept an added fee for night or weekend break service. Exactly how much does a plumbing professional expense for urgent service? Sometimes, weekend break and evening costs can be 2 to 3 times a plumbing's normal rate.
